WebJun 19, 2024 · Pool coping is the manner in which the pool shell wall is capped either through poured in place concrete or pre-cast concrete materials such as tile and natural stone. When a person is hanging onto the edge of the pool and placing their arm on edge, the coping is the part of the pool they are hanging onto. To identify the source of the leak, first turn the filter pump off. Take the lid off the skimmer, and remove the pump basket, the skimmer weir and the diverter, if it has one. Although an in-ground concrete pool is durable, over time its inner surface can chip, crack, fade or discolor. Refinishing or resurfacing can extend the life of a structurally sound pool by repairing surface imperfections. black holes compared to the sun
